Embrace

Every new resident begins in Embrace. This is your time to breathe, stabilize, and prepare for the next step

Embrace is our short-term program designed to provide immediate safety, shelter, and stability during your time of crisis. During this phase, you’ll settle in, begin building healthy routines, and work with our staff to assess your needs and goals.

  • Safe housing and essentials for you and your child
  • 30-day intake and orientation period
  • Mental health assessment through Therapy Treatment Team
  • Connection to prenatal care and medical services
  • Assistance enrolling in public benefits (WIC, Medicaid, etc.)
  • Introduction to case management and goal setting

Empower

This is where you’ll grow the most.
It’s not always easy, but you won’t do it alone.

Once you’ve stabilized, Empower is where real transformation begins. This phase focuses on building the life skills, education, and confidence you’ll need to stand on your own. You’ll work closely with your case manager to create an individualized plan for your future. Empower is our long-term program at Sunlight Home. It gives you the opportunity to stay with us for up to 3 years.

  • Financial literacy and budgeting support
  • Ongoing mental health counseling
  • Community mentorship and spiritual enrichment
  • Continuation of Personalized case management and weekly goal coaching
  • Enrollment in school (GED, college, vocational) or employment support

Embark

Leaving Sunlight Home doesn’t mean leaving our family. We’re here for you long after you walk out the door.

Embark is the final phase — preparing you to step into independent living with confidence. By this point, you’ll have built the skills, savings, and support network you need. Our team will walk alongside you as you transition out, making sure you and your child are set up for lasting success.

  • Individualized transition planning
  • Housing search assistance and referrals
  • Continued case management through your move-out
  • Connection to community resources and ongoing support
  • Coordination with outside agencies for continued care
  • Departure interview and aftercare planning
